Janice Elrod

Janice started her aviation career as a US Air Force aircraft mechanic then joining the Air Force Reserve as a Technician at Carswell AFB, Texas. Subsequently, Janice accepted a position with the Defense Logistics Agency, Defense Contract Administration Service (DCSC) as a Quality Assurance Representative. She worked on such projects as the overhaul and modification of the Presidential aircraft, the flying command post, and the AWAC's airplane. Janice was later promoted to headquarters staff, after moving through a series of position with DCSC Janice accepted a position with the Federal Aviation Administration (FAA). Janice has worked for the FAA in Long Beach, California and Washington, DC. Presently, Janice is a Technical & Program Management Specialist in the Manufacturing Inspection Office, Fort Worth, Texas.

Janice is actively involved and has been elected as an officer in several aviation organizations. Janice is the current secretary for Women In Aviation, International. Janice has be recognized for her efforts to educate others about the opportunities for women in aviation and has received the FAA Administrators Superior Achievement award for her accomplishments in helping ensure that women are represented in the FAA.
